Nominate the Next IOP Editor Jenny Baker / Wednesday, September 9, 2020 0 3336 Article rating: No rating SIOP is now soliciting nominations for the position of editor-in-chief of Industrial and Organizational Psychology: Perspectives on Science and Practice (IOP). The new editor will be selected by the Publications Board and approved by the Executive Board in March 2021. The new editor-in-training would begin working with the current editor, Ronald Landis, beginning March 2021, and assumes duty beginning September 1, 2021. The term of the position is 3 years.
